Re: [1.1.61] wrong save timestamp

Post by Bilka »

Looks like you played for long enough to have the game tick overflow. See for example 101341. Only you got lucky and didn't have the game lock up on you. The linked thread has a command to fix the radar coverage problem. The messages seem like a problem with the chat message timeout, /clear might fix it.

101621 suggests that you may also get an issue with deconstruction marks disappearing.

Re: [1.1.61] wrong save timestamp

Post by spiral_power »

Thanks for the reply. I read through the whole thing.

I see, so there is a wall every 19,884 hours.

The radar visibility problem seems to have returned to normal with the rechart command.
And all the obtrusive messages on the left have disappeared.
The deconstruction feature seems to be working fine at this time.

I don't use any belts in this Bob's save. This may be why the freezing problem did not occur.
However, I am concerned because my Space-Exploration save, which is running in parallel, is almost at 10,000 hours and uses a lot of belts.
An attempt to overcome the overflow barrier with editors will have to be done eventually.
